What is an Analyst?

An Analyst is an umbrella term that covers a variety of job roles and responsibilities. Generally speaking, analysts are responsible for gathering data, interpreting information, producing reports, and making predictions based on their findings. They play a pivotal role in helping companies make well-informed decisions by providing valuable insights from the data they collected.

Usually, Analysts can start their careers with a bachelor’s degree in accounting, business administration, finance, business management, or a related field. They may have completed internships or have certifications.

What does an Analyst do?

An Analyst is a professional who assesses and interprets data, often with the aim of making decisions or providing solutions to complex problems. They use their knowledge of data analysis techniques and business acumen to investigate patterns, trends, and relationships in data sets to develop strategic insights. Analysts can work in fields such as finance, economics, market research, marketing, and more. The duties of an Analyst typically include gathering and analyzing data, developing solutions to business problems, presenting findings to stakeholders, creating reports on performance and outcomes, as well as any other tasks related to providing strategic business insights. An Analyst may also be responsible for researching industry trends, utilizing statistical methods to draw conclusions from large sets of data, performing cost/benefit analyses on proposed initiatives or strategies, and making recommendations based on the results. Additionally, they may suggest process improvements in order to increase efficiency or reduce costs.

Analyst Interview Questions

Some good Analyst Interview Questions to ask include:

  • What interests you about working as an analyst?
  • Describe a complex problem that you have solved in your previous job.
  • How do you go about researching and synthesizing data?
  • Explain how you would create meaningful insights from large datasets.
  • Tell me how your past experience is relevant to the current role.
  • What techniques or technologies have you used to analyze data?
  • Describe how you would use data to inform decisions.
  • What methods do you use to present your analysis findings?
  • How do you ensure that your conclusions are accurate and reliable?
  • What strategies would you employ when faced with ambiguous data sets?
  • How do you troubleshoot any issues or discrepancies that arise in your analysis?
  • What processes did you use to prepare for the presentation?
  • How do you collaborate with other departments in order to ensure the accuracy and validity of reports?

Why is it important to prepare when interviewing a job applicant?

It is important for an interviewer to prepare before interviewing an Analyst for a job and hiring the best candidate in order to ensure that they are making the right decision. By preparing for the interview, the interviewer will be able to evaluate a candidate’s qualifications, skills, experience, and personality to gauge whether they are the right fit for the role. Interviewers may ask a range of questions about the candidate’s experience and qualifications as well as their ability to use data, software, and systems. At the same time, they should also be able to assess the candidate’s attitude towards collaboration and teamwork, their aptitude for learning new concepts or technologies, and their eagerness to take on responsibilities.

By asking thought-provoking questions that go beyond what can be found in a resume or cover letter, interviewers can gain a better understanding of the candidate and make an informed hiring decision. By taking the time to properly prepare for an Analyst interview, interviewing managers can identify the right candidate for the job and build a successful team that will contribute positively to the organization’s overall growth.
